PH internet speed climbs in global ranking

The Philippines moved up in the global ranking in mobile and fixed broadband internet speed.

Based on the May 2021 Ookla Speedtest Global Index Report for the mobile internet speed, the Philippines has climbed seven spots to achieve the 77th ranking over 137 countries.

According to the report, the average mobile download speed in the country is 31.98 Megabits per second (Mbps) while its upload speed is at 8.74 Mbps. The average mobile download speed in the country in April was 29.12 Mbps and has an upload speed of 7.65 Mbps.

Meanwhile, in the fixed broadband speed ranking, the Philippines has jumped over 15 spots, claiming the 65th rank globally.

The average download speed for fixed broadband internet is 58.73 Mbps while its upload speed is at 57.40 Mbps. In April, the average download speed of the fixed broadband internet was 49.31 Mbps while its upload was at 47.83 Mbps.
